Titanic 4D Simulator offers a unique mobile experience, placing you aboard the iconic RMS Titanic. This app is not a traditional game but an interactive simulation, allowing you to explore the famous ship's detailed decks and witness its final hours from a first-person perspective. It combines historical exploration with a powerful, atmospheric journey.
Exclusive Features of Titanic 4D Simulator
Titanic 4D Simulator provides a deeply immersive environment. Users can navigate through meticulously recreated areas of the ship, from the grand staircase to the boiler rooms. The simulation includes a real-time sinking sequence synchronized with historical events. The 4D element is activated through device features, offering haptic feedback like vibrations to mimic the ship's distress. This level of detail sets Titanic 4D Simulator apart from other historical apps.

FAQs
Q: Is Titanic 4D Simulator a game?
A: It is more accurately described as an interactive historical simulation. There are no goals or scores, only exploration and observation.
Q: Does the app require an internet connection?
A: No, once downloaded, Titanic 4D Simulator functions offline, allowing for uninterrupted exploration.
Q: Is the content historically accurate?
A: The developers state that the ship's model and the timeline of the sinking sequence are based on extensive historical research.
Q: Are there in-app purchases?
A: The base version of Titanic 4D Simulator is typically a paid download. Some versions may offer additional content or areas for purchase.
